DYPSOAC offers full‑time UG and PG programs in the arts and commerce fields. There are 3 courses offered at DY Patil University's School of Arts and Commerce, Navi Mumbai. The courses include B.Com, BA, and M.Com. The flagship courses at DY Patil University's School of Arts and Commerce Navi Mumbai are B.Com.
DY Patil University's School of Arts and Commerce, Navi Mumbai, fees 2024-2025 is INR 1.8 Lakhs to INR 3 Lakhs depending upon the course. This institute does not have any cutoff system. The institution takes admission through merit and the college’s personal entrance test, with a personal interview.

DY Patil University’s School of Arts and Commerce UG Admission 2025
UG Admissions are based on merit in 10+2 (45% minimum) and D. Y. Patil Common Entrance Test(DYPCET) score, coordinated via DY Patil University central counselling. Selection is finalized after a Personal Interview. Application Mode is online via the official DY Patil University portal, with application fees of INR 1,550 for UG and INR 2,150 for PG programs.

DY Patil University's School of Arts And Commerce Admission Process 2025
- Visit the official website dypatil.edu and fill out the online application form.
- Then, appear for the D.Y. Patil Common Entrance Test (DYPCET) with a personal interview.
- Based on 10+2 marks (for UG) or Graduation scores (for PG) and performance in DYPCET/PI, a merit list will be declared.
- Appear for documentation verification.
- Pay the admission fees online or offline as per the offer letter to secure your seat and confirm final admission.
